Abstract
The Water Resources Division of the U.S. Geological Survey, in cooperation with State, Federal, and other local governmental agencies, obtains a large amount of data pertaining to the water resources of Maine each water year. These data, accumulated during the many water years, constitute a valuable data base for developing an improved understanding of the water resources of the State.
Water resources data for the 1989 water year for Maine consist of records of stage, discharge, and water quality of streams; stage and contents of lakes and reservoirs; and water levels and water quality of ground-water wells. This report contains discharge records for 51 gaging stations; stage only for 2 gaging stations; contents for 17 lakes and reservoirs; water quality for 13 gaging stations; and water-levels for 30 ground-water wells. Additional water data were collected at other sites, not part of the systematic data collection program, and are published as miscellaneous measurements.
